Standard Cataract Surgery Pros and Cons
When thinking about typical cataract surgical procedure, you might find that it's a well-established and widely-used technique. In this procedure, a surgeon makes a little cut in the eye and utilizes ultrasound to separate the over cast lens before removing it. When the cataract is gotten rid of, a fabricated lens is inserted to bring back clear vision.
Among the main benefits of traditional cataract surgical treatment is its track record of success. Lots of patients have actually had their vision substantially boosted via this treatment. Additionally, traditional surgical procedure is commonly covered by insurance coverage, making it an extra obtainable alternative for numerous individuals.
However, there are some drawbacks to typical cataract surgical procedure as well. Recovery time can be longer contrasted to more recent techniques, and there's a slightly greater danger of complications such as infection or swelling. Some patients might additionally experience astigmatism or need analysis glasses post-surgery.

Comparative Evaluation of Both Techniques
For a detailed understanding of cataract surgery techniques, it's important to perform a comparative evaluation of both conventional and laser-assisted methods.
Traditional cataract surgical procedure includes manual incisions and using portable devices to break up and get rid of the gloomy lens.
On the other hand, laser-assisted cataract surgical treatment makes use of advanced modern technology to create precise incisions and break up the cataract with laser energy before removing it.
